When Amy Burton's mother-in-law buys her and her husband Eric a lovely old mansion, it sounds like a dream come true for the young couple. But there's something not quite right about the house. Old Mrs. Mac, who has psychic gifts, is the first to notice a sinister aura, and then there are the weird cries in the night and the scratching of a ghostly black dog at the door. Even stranger is the fact that the old house is not really old, but for some mysterious reason has been made to look that way.
At last Amy learns the unspeakable truth about a horrible deed committed in the house. But Amy has secrets of her own, buried deep within her memory and struggling to break free to the surface. The terror at the Burton house mounts, but is it really haunted, or is it all just in Amy's mind? Readers will find the book impossible to put down until its final shocking revelation.
Inspired in part by a real-life case, Rohan O'Grady's
Bleak November
(1970) is an exceptional Gothic novel with a genuinely creepy atmosphere, a slow-building sense of dread, and enough twists and turns to keep readers guessing.
